Transaction 694582e3375bd840aa7e5e3744807379e09cd3081dc8b9f370e5da249e939515
1 Input
1 Output
-
694582e3375bd840aa7e5e3744807379e09cd3081dc8b9f370e5da249e939515:0
- value
- 1322718
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d954d835e4ab3e0e4babb6040882ec7230635f0c OP_EQUAL
- address
- 3MWACGuzSdiGQK4N1yAPQKpYn176nqrqyr